Earl looking to conquer Europe at the Palace

Posted: 08 Jun 2006, 10:27
by kevin
Graham Earl will take on European champion Juan Melero-Diaz at the National Sports Centre in Crystal Palace on the 14th July.

In an intriguing chief support, Pete McDonagh shows he's got loads of bottle by taking on Yuri Romanov over eight rounds.

Also featuring Jamie Moore.

David Haye's European title fight will now take place at the York Hall on the 21st July.
